Pericytes: blood-brain barrier safeguards against neurodegeneration?

Annelies Quaegebeur1, Inmaculada Segura, Peter Carmeliet.   

Abstract

The role of pericytes in the control of blood-brain barrier (BBB) integrity has remained enigmatic. In this issue, Bell et al. and two concurrent studies highlight that pericyte loss causes BBB breakdown and hypoperfusion. Remarkably, these vascular changes precede neurodegeneration and cognitive defects in old age.
